CC -!- FUNCTION: Converts stearoyl-ACP to oleoyl-ACP by introduction of a cis
CC double bond between carbons 9 and 10 of the acyl chain.
CC {ECO:0000256|ARBA:ARBA00037304}.
CC -!- FUNCTION: Introduction of a cis double bond between carbons of the acyl
CC chain. {ECO:0000256|RuleBase:RU000582}.
